[Flux] gguf PuLID with Inpaint is for editing an input image with PuLID and inpainting; it takes an image through LoadImage, includes mask handling, and saves an image output through SaveImage.
The listed stages cover image resizing, VAE encoding and decoding, mask handling, guidance, sampling, and image saving.
PuLID-specific processing uses ApplyPulidFlux, PulidFluxModelLoader, PulidFluxInsightFaceLoader, and PulidFluxEvaClipLoader.
Image and mask handling uses LoadImage, ImageResize+, VAEEncode, SetLatentNoiseMask, and MaskPreview+.
VAEDecode and SaveImage handle decoding and saving the image output.
